Mirek
22nd June 2021, 20:02
Can you please explain this to someone who is not an engineer? :) The electric motor will do the same job as ALS? So there will be no more banging sound?

Yes, the function of ALS is to keep the turbo rotating at maximum speed when the throttle valve is closed. The larger the turbo, the higher inertia it has and the more it suffers from lagging. It means it takes more time to accelerate it to full speed and to deliver the maximum boost. The electric engine can add the torque which is missing without ALS during the initial acceleration. It removes the bang but it also removes the main source of fuel inefficiency, i.e. it is somewhat green while the car performance doesn't suffer.


As far as I understand, removing the fresh air ALS will also improve emissions, no?

Yes, for sure.

AnttiL
25th August 2021, 08:54
Those Hyundai tests that Wuorela attended were likely very preliminary, could be just tests to see what happens to the car when they run jumps, and they were absolutely not allowed to crash the car.

At the same time, it's completely expected that Rally1 cars will have slower corner speed than current WRC because of less aero and simpler transmission. As for comparing to R5, that type of cars weren't present in the test that day, and even if they were, it would be questionable if anyone can judge cornering speed just by watching.

mknight
1st September 2021, 17:21
I’m not sure what to make of that, but something doesn’t seem right. It almost looks like the gearing is long to use the hybrid boost, but the hybrid wasn’t working or connected. It looked, and sounded really flat.
What did you think?

To me it looked like the electric engine either wasn't on or wasn't properly synchronized with the petrol engine in 3/4 of the hairpin passes. The car turns and then there is a lul before power comes.
Might be that they are also testing different ways (programs) to use the hybrid.

Fourmaux mentioned in the recent interview that FIA hasn't decided on when and how it will be used and wants to make it as unpredictable as possible. That sounds like a really bad idea to me.
The basics rules on when and how it can be used should be decided as soon as possible cause they likely can affect tons of other areas of the car and need much more testing to fine-tune.

At the same time there likely needs to be some strict rules so it doesn't turn into "programmers competition". (at one point some team mentioned they could program when it will be used individually for each stage based on corners/profile ++, that sounds like a recipe for cost explosion.)
